Answer key

For grown-ups. Fold this page away before handing over the rest.

Turning thin air into sugar W1-mt_zGOCx9mNrx-s1

  1. The five-carbon acceptor for carbon dioxide · RuBP is the acceptor that carbon dioxide joins.
  2. Rubisco · Rubisco bolts carbon dioxide onto RuBP.
  3. True · Only a small spare leaves; the rest rebuilds the acceptor.
  4. Joined onto RuBP · Fixation onto RuBP is the entry step.
  5. Reducing GP to triose and rebuilding RuBP · They pay for reduction and for rebuilding the acceptor.
  6. Most triose rebuilds RuBP, leaving one spare · Recycling eats almost everything the cycle makes.
  7. It uses carriers, not light · Light work happens in the thylakoids, not here.
  8. Its carrier stocks drain away · No light means no refill of the imported stocks.
